Which CC to get for Electricity bill?

I'm paying multiple electricity bills total around Rs.25,000 bi-monthly. Can anyone suggest a way to gain maximum cashback for this and which credit card to apply (I own Airtel Axis CC, HDFC Moneyback DC, SBI Platinum DC)? And how can i gain cashback for CC bill? Please suggest.

It's good to know you did some research and got some ideas. There is no single trick that works for everyone.

For example, even if I get multiple electricity bills bi-monthly, I pay them in such a way, there is always a bill every month. So, almost half of the bills are paid one month and another half in another month. This method may not work if you are running a business where the customers expect instant payment and receipt.

A single bill vs multiple bills makes a huge difference. Single bill is tough to maximize rewards. Multiple small bills are each to make good money.

You already have good credit cards. Along with them, you might want to add RuPay platinum debit card that has offers on each Friday for a maximum of Rs.100 per month. One can easily get multiple debit cards (RuPay platinum).
